.col-md-6 {
  width:48%  ;  float: left;
}
.index-one-left{
  position: relative;
}
.news-list li a:hover {
        color: #144ba3;
}
 .right-news .hot-news h4 a:hover {
     color: #144ba3;
}

.carousel {
	position:relative
}
.carousel-inner {
	position:relative;
	width:100%;
	overflow:hidden
}
.carousel-inner>.item {
	position:relative;
	display:none;
	-webkit-transition:.6s ease-in-out left;
	-o-transition:.6s ease-in-out left;
	transition:.6s ease-in-out left
}
.carousel-inner>.item>a>img,.carousel-inner>.item>img {
	line-height:1
}
@media all and (transform-3d),(-webkit-transform-3d) {
	.carousel-inner>.item {
		-webkit-transition:-webkit-transform .6s ease-in-out;
		-o-transition:-o-transform .6s ease-in-out;
		transition:transform .6s ease-in-out;
		-webkit-backface-visibility:hidden;
		backface-visibility:hidden;
		-webkit-perspective:1000;
		perspective:1000
	}
	.carousel-inner>.item.active.right,.carousel-inner>.item.next {
		left:0;
		-webkit-transform:translate3d(100%,0,0);
		transform:translate3d(100%,0,0)
	}
	.carousel-inner>.item.active.left,.carousel-inner>.item.prev {
		left:0;
		-webkit-transform:translate3d(-100%,0,0);
		transform:translate3d(-100%,0,0)
	}
	.carousel-inner>.item.active,.carousel-inner>.item.next.left,.carousel-inner>.item.prev.right {
		left:0;
		-webkit-transform:translate3d(0,0,0);
		transform:translate3d(0,0,0)
	}
}
.carousel-inner>.active,.carousel-inner>.next,.carousel-inner>.prev {
	display:block
}
.carousel-inner>.active {
	left:0
}
.carousel-inner>.next,.carousel-inner>.prev {
	position:absolute;
	top:0;
	width:100%
}
.carousel-inner>.next {
	left:100%
}
.carousel-inner>.prev {
	left:-100%
}
.carousel-inner>.next.left,.carousel-inner>.prev.right {
	left:0
}
.carousel-inner>.active.left {
	left:-100%
}
.carousel-inner>.active.right {
	left:100%
}
.carousel-control {
	position:absolute;
	top:0;
	bottom:0;
	left:0;
	width:15%;
	font-size:20px;
	color:#fff;
	text-align:center;
	text-shadow:0 1px 2px rgba(0,0,0,.6);
	filter:alpha(opacity=50);
	opacity:.5
}
.carousel-control.left {
	background-image:-webkit-linear-gradient(left,rgba(0,0,0,.5) 0,rgba(0,0,0,.0001) 100%);
	background-image:-o-linear-gradient(left,rgba(0,0,0,.5) 0,rgba(0,0,0,.0001) 100%);
	background-image:-webkit-gradient(linear,left top,right top,from(rgba(0,0,0,.5)),to(rgba(0,0,0,.0001)));
	background-image:linear-gradient(to right,rgba(0,0,0,.5) 0,rgba(0,0,0,.0001) 100%);
	filter:progid:DXImageTransform.Microsoft.gradient(startColorstr='#80000000', endColorstr='#00000000', GradientType=1);
	background-repeat:repeat-x
}
.carousel-control.right {
	right:0;
	left:auto;
	background-image:-webkit-linear-gradient(left,rgba(0,0,0,.0001) 0,rgba(0,0,0,.5) 100%);
	background-image:-o-linear-gradient(left,rgba(0,0,0,.0001) 0,rgba(0,0,0,.5) 100%);
	background-image:-webkit-gradient(linear,left top,right top,from(rgba(0,0,0,.0001)),to(rgba(0,0,0,.5)));
	background-image:linear-gradient(to right,rgba(0,0,0,.0001) 0,rgba(0,0,0,.5) 100%);
	filter:progid:DXImageTransform.Microsoft.gradient(startColorstr='#00000000', endColorstr='#80000000', GradientType=1);
	background-repeat:repeat-x
}
.carousel-control:focus,.carousel-control:hover {
	color:#fff;
	text-decoration:none;
	filter:alpha(opacity=90);
	outline:0;
	opacity:.9
}
.carousel-control .glyphicon-chevron-left,.carousel-control .glyphicon-chevron-right,.carousel-control .icon-next,.carousel-control .icon-prev {
	position:absolute;
	top:50%;
	z-index:5;
	display:inline-block
}
.carousel-control .glyphicon-chevron-left,.carousel-control .icon-prev {
	left:50%;
	margin-left:-10px
}
.carousel-control .glyphicon-chevron-right,.carousel-control .icon-next {
	right:50%;
	margin-right:-10px
}
.carousel-control .icon-next,.carousel-control .icon-prev {
	width:20px;
	height:20px;
	margin-top:-10px;
	font-family:serif;
	line-height:1
}
.carousel-control .icon-prev:before {
	content:'\2039'
}
.carousel-control .icon-next:before {
	content:'\203a'
}
.carousel-indicators {
	position:absolute;
	bottom:10px;
	left:50%;
	z-index:15;
	width:60%;
	padding-left:0;
	margin-left:-30%;
	text-align:center;
	list-style:none
}
.carousel-indicators li {
	display:inline-block;
	width:10px;
	height:10px;
	margin:1px;
	text-indent:-999px;
	cursor:pointer;
	background-color:#000 \9;
	background-color:rgba(0,0,0,0);
	border:1px solid #fff;
	border-radius:10px
}
.carousel-indicators .active {
	width:12px;
	height:12px;
	margin:0;
	background-color:#fff
}
.carousel-caption {
	position:absolute;
	right:15%;
	bottom:20px;
	left:15%;
	z-index:10;
	padding-top:20px;
	padding-bottom:20px;
	color:#fff;
	text-align:center;
	text-shadow:0 1px 2px rgba(0,0,0,.6)
}
.carousel-caption .btn {
	text-shadow:none
}


.index-one-left .carousel-inner img{
  height: 260px;
  object-fit: cover;
}
.content-shadow{
  height: 38px;
  background: -webkit-linear-gradient(rgba(0,0,0,0), rgba(0,0,0,1)); /* Safari 5.1 - 6.0 */
  background: -o-linear-gradient(rgba(0,0,0,0), rgba(0,0,0,1)); /* Opera 11.1 - 12.0 */
  background: -moz-linear-gradient(rgba(0,0,0,0), rgba(0,0,0,1)); /* Firefox 3.6 - 15 */
  background: linear-gradient(rgba(0,0,0,0), rgba(0,0,0,1)); /* æ ‡å‡†çš„è¯­æ³•ï¼ˆå¿…é¡»æ”¾åœ¨æœ€åŽï¼‰ */
  position: absolute;
  bottom: 0;
  width: 100%;
}
.content-shadow p{
  line-height: 38px;
  font-size: 14px;
  color: #fff;
  overflow: hidden;
  margin: 0;
  display: inline-block;
  width: 75%;
  overflow: hidden;
  white-space: nowrap;
  text-overflow: ellipsis;
  text-indent: 2em;
}
.content-shadow p a {
  color: inherit;
}
.btn-group-vertical>.btn-group:after,.btn-group-vertical>.btn-group:before,.btn-toolbar:after,.btn-toolbar:before,.clearfix:after,.clearfix:before,.container-fluid:after,.container-fluid:before,.container:after,.container:before,.dl-horizontal dd:after,.dl-horizontal dd:before,.form-horizontal .form-group:after,.form-horizontal .form-group:before,.modal-footer:after,.modal-footer:before,.nav:after,.nav:before,.navbar-collapse:after,.navbar-collapse:before,.navbar-header:after,.navbar-header:before,.navbar:after,.navbar:before,.pager:after,.pager:before,.panel-body:after,.panel-body:before,.row:after,.row:before {
	display:table;
	content:" "
}
.btn-group-vertical>.btn-group:after,.btn-toolbar:after,.clearfix:after,.container-fluid:after,.container:after,.dl-horizontal dd:after,.form-horizontal .form-group:after,.modal-footer:after,.nav:after,.navbar-collapse:after,.navbar-header:after,.navbar:after,.pager:after,.panel-body:after,.row:after {
	clear:both
}
.row {
	margin-right:0;
	margin-left:0
}
.col-md-v-dis {
  padding-bottom: 60px;
}
.title-head {
  margin-top: 60px;
  margin-bottom: 28px;
  border-bottom: 1px solid #ccc;
}
.title-head p {
  position: relative;
  margin-bottom: 0;
  margin-top: 0;
  font-size: 12px;
}
.title-head p .title {
    font-size: 18px;
    color: #144ba3;
    display: inline-block;
    padding-bottom: 12px;
    border-bottom: 2px solid #144ba3;
    font-weight: bold;
}
.title-head p .title span{
  margin-right: 5px;
}
.title-head p span.word {
  color: #ccc;
  display: inline-block;
  transform: scale(1, 1.3);
  font-weight: bold;
  font-size: 15px;
  margin-left: 5px;
  display: none;
}
.title-head p label {
  position: absolute;
  bottom: 0;
  right: 0;
  color: #999;
  margin-bottom: 12px;
}
.title-head p label a {
  font-size: 12px;
  font-weight: normal;
  color: inherit;
  display: inline-block;
}
.right-news {
  position: relative;
  padding-left: 90px;
  padding-bottom: 7px;
  border-bottom: 1px dashed #ccc;
}
.right-news .hot-news h4 {
  font-size: 16px;
  margin-top: 0;
  margin-bottom: 7px;
}
.right-news .hot-news h4 a {
  color: #333;
  line-height: 24px;
}
.right-news .hot-news p {
  font-size: 12px;
  color: #999;
  line-height: 22px;
  overflow: hidden;
  text-overflow: ellipsis;
  display: -webkit-box;
  -webkit-line-clamp: 3;
  -webkit-box-orient: vertical;
  height: 65px;

}
.right-news .hot-news p a {
  color: #333;
}
.right-bottom-dis {
  margin-bottom: 15px;
}
.right-hot-news h4 {
  font-size: 16px;
  margin-top: 0;
}
.right-hot-news h4 a {
  color: #333;
  line-height: 24px;
}
.right-hot-news span {
  font-size: 12px;
  color: #999;
}
.news-list li {
  padding-top: 15px;
  position: relative;
}
.news-list li a {
  display: inline-block;
  width: 77%;
  overflow: hidden;
  white-space: nowrap;
  text-overflow: ellipsis;
  color: #333;
  float: right;
}
.news-list .right-date {
  display: inline-block;
  font-size: 12px;
  color: #999;
  right: 0;
  top: 11px;
}
.date {
  position: absolute;
  left: 0;
  top: 0;
  height: 72px;
  width: 60px;
  border:1px solid #144ba3;
  border-radius: 4px;
}
.date .day {
    display: table;
    width: 100%;
    text-align: center;
    height: 42px;
    background: #fff;
    color: #144ba3;
    border-radius: 4px;
}
.date .day .day-inline {
  font-size: 27px;
  display: table-cell;
  vertical-align: middle;
}
.date .month {
    background-color: #144ba3;
    color: #fff;
    position: absolute;
    left: 0;
    right: 0;
    top: auto;
    bottom: 0;
    text-align: center;
    color: #fff;
    line-height: 28px;
    border-bottom-left-radius: 4px;
    border-bottom-right-radius: 4px;
}
.firend-links {
  padding-bottom: 60px;
  background:url(../images/bg2.png);
}
.firend-links a {
  color: #333;
}
.firend-links .friend-activity .my-spa-p {
  color: #999;
  width: 100%;
  overflow: hidden;
  white-space: nowrap;
  text-overflow: ellipsis;
}
.firend-links .friend-activity li {
  position: relative;
  padding-left: 55px;
  margin-bottom: 20px;
}
.firend-links .friend-activity li .date {
  width: 40px;
  height: 47px;
}
.firend-links .friend-activity li .date .day {
  height: 30px;
}
.firend-links .friend-activity li .date .day .day-inline {
  font-size: 12px;
}
.firend-links .friend-activity li .date .month {
  top: 30px;
  font-size: 12px;
}
.firend-links .friend-activity li .datail-p {
  font-size: 12px;
  color: #999;
  width: 100%;
  overflow: hidden;
  white-space: nowrap;
  text-overflow: ellipsis;
}
.firend-links .friend-activity li .datail-p a {
  color: #999;
}
.firend-links .friend-activity.friend-news .friend-date {
  color: #fff;
  font-size: 12px;
  display: inline-block;
  position: absolute;
  left: 0;
  top: 0;
  background: #b10c2f; 
  border-radius: 4px;
  padding: 2px 4px;

}
.firend-links .friend-activity.friend-news .datail-p {
  color: #333;
  font-size: 14px;
  margin-bottom: 15px;
}
.firend-links .friend-activity.friend-news .datail-p a {
  color: #333;
}
.firend-links .friend-activity.friend-news.friend-story li {
  padding-left: 65px;
}
.firend-links .friend-activity.friend-news.friend-story li .small-deatil {
  font-size: 12px;
  color: #999;
  margin-bottom: 35px;
}
.firend-links .friend-activity.friend-news.friend-story li .small-deatil a {
  color: #999;
}
.firend-links .friend-activity.friend-news.friend-story .circle-wrap {
  width: 50px;
  height: 50px;
  position: absolute;
  top: 0;
  left: 0;
}
.firend-links .friend-activity.friend-news.friend-story .circle-wrap img {
  width: 100%;
  height: 100%;
}
.friend-books {
  padding-top: 60px;
  padding-bottom: 60px;
}
.friend-books .title-head {
  margin-top: 0;
}
.friend-books .title-head p label {
  margin-bottom: 0;
}
.friend-books .title-head p  button {
  font-size: 12px;
  color: #999;
  border-bottom: 0;
  border-bottom-left-radius: 0;
  border-bottom-right-radius: 0;
}

.friend-books .title-head .btn:hover {
  background-color: #b10c2f;
  color: #fff;
}


.title-head .crew{
    position: absolute;
    bottom: 0;
    right: 0;
    color: #999;
}